When you need to buy MBBR bio media, there are important things to think about. MBBR Biofilm Carriers stands for Moving Bed Biofilm Reactor. This media is used in water treatment to help clean wastewater. It is made of special materials that help bacteria grow. The bacteria eat up the bad things in the water, making it clean again. Choosing the right bio media can make a big difference in how well your water cleaning system works. This is why it's important to know what to look for when buying it. What to Look for in Quality MBBR Bio Media for Wholesale Purchases?
When you are looking for quality MBBR bio media, there are several factors to keep in mind. First, the material used in making the bio media is very important. It should be strong, durable, and resistant to different kinds of chemicals. This is because it will be submerged in water that can contain various substances. You want something that won't break down easily. The size and shape of the media also matter. It should have enough surface area for bacteria to grow, but not be too big that it clogs up the system. For example, smaller pieces can move around better and create more space for the water to flow.
Another key factor is the density of the media. If it's too heavy, it might sink too fast, while if it's too light, it might float on the surface. You want a balance that allows it to stay in the right place in the water. It's also helpful to look for bio media that has been tested for its effectiveness. This means it has been proven to work well in treating wastewater. When buying in bulk, make sure the supplier offers a variety of options. This way, you can choose what fits your needs best. Common Issues When Using MBBR Bio Media and How to Avoid Them
When using MBBR (Moving Bed Biofilm Reactor) bio media, there can be some common problems. One issue is the clogging of the media. This happens when dirt and waste build up on the bio media, making it hard for water to flow through. When this occurs, it can slow down the treatment process. To avoid clogging, it is important to regularly check and clean the MBBR system. You can do this by removing some of the media and rinsing it with clean water. Another problem is the growth of unwanted bacteria. Sometimes, bad bacteria can grow instead of the good bacteria needed to treat wastewater. To help with this, make sure the water has the right conditions, like the proper temperature and pH level. These conditions should be checked often to ensure good bacteria can thrive.
Also, the size of the bio media can be a concern. If the pieces are too small, they may get stuck together, which can create a blockage. If they are too big, they may not provide enough surface area for bacteria to grow. It is best to choose the right size of bio media for your system. What Are the Key Benefits of MBBR Bio Media in Wastewater Treatment?
MBBR bio media has many important benefits for treating wastewater. One of the biggest advantages is its ability to handle large amounts of wastewater. This is great for industries and cities that produce a lot of dirty water. The bio media has a large surface area, which allows many good bacteria to grow. These bacteria help break down harmful substances in the wastewater, making it cleaner and safer for the environment.
Another benefit is that MBBR systems are flexible. They can be added to existing wastewater treatment systems without needing a lot of changes. This helps facilities save time and money, as they do not need to build a whole new treatment plant. How MBBR Bio Media Improves Efficiency in Biological Treatment Systems?
MBBR biological carriers improve efficiency of biological treatment systems in a number of ways. Firstly, they allow beneficial bacteria to grow well. The biological carriers provide a safe environment where the bacteria can attach themselves and develop well. This ensures that the bacteria break down the organic matter in the water much faster. In other words, when the bacteria are healthy and abundant, the process becomes fast.
Another way MBBR bio media improves efficiency is by allowing for better oxygen transfer. The design of the bio media helps air mix well with the water, giving bacteria the oxygen they need to work effectively. When bacteria have enough oxygen, they can break down waste faster. This means that less time is needed to treat the wastewater.
MBBR systems also require less space compared to traditional methods. Because the bio media is very effective, it can fit into smaller areas without losing performance. This is especially helpful for cities or industries that may not have a lot of space for treatment plants.
